1. An apparatus for controlling a hydraulic pump for an excavator, comprising:

  • an operating unit generating an operation signal according to an operation of an operator, and including a joystick or a pedal;

    an oil flow supplying unit supplying oil to a plurality of actuators, in order to drive the plurality of actuators corresponding to the operation signal, and including a plurality of pumps and a plurality of logic valves; and

    a control unit controlling the oil flow supplying unit by using a priority algorithm for each operation considering a use frequency and a load of the plurality of actuators with respect to a change of a predetermined operation mode according to the operation signal for the plurality of the actuators;

    wherein at least one of the plurality of the actuators comprises a travelling device, andwherein when operation signals for the plurality of actuators are input, and an operation signal corresponding to the travelling device is input, the control unit first assigns two pumps to the travelling device for supplying oil to the travelling device.
